Water branding!!!!

"I look back on life, its funny how things turn out. You a connoisseur of fast food, now gaze at water that took years to make and I some of the purest water in the world stand here trapped in a bottle. Come enjoy the irony……"

Are you wondering what is it that I have written on top… well this is a phrase that you will find on the “Himalayan” natural mineral water, a Tata product. I have been now drinking this bottled water for some time and I have always really liked the way these words have been so beautifully phrased… and enjoyed drinking the water after having a kind of “feel good feeling” (if that is a right phrase to use )in my mind. This is just not the only phrase, there are several such different phrases on each bottle. Today I could remember this phrase even without the bottle in my hand coz I coincidentally seemed to have got this phrase for three times now.
I feel this is a very good branding technique , different and catches the customers attention.

If you happen to pick this bottle up next time, don’t miss reading these phrases. Jet Airways serves only these bottles off late…

C/O Joseph Annaya

It was September 2000 when Vinayak and myself were desperately looking for a house on rent. We were to get married in Nov and he was in a bachelor’s accomadation which was not possible for me to go and live. We started our search saw many houses, but liked few and the few we liked were not ready to give us the house since we were still not married and they wanted us to get back when we were married..

While we went to one such house, there was a lady on the road who over heard our conversation and told us of a house that was on the main WOC road. She just said that it belongs to a gentleman by name Joseph who visited the church with them. She said he is really good man and we should try our luck there. Desperation made us to quickly search the place and go meet him. He was a well built man at the age of 76 then. We told him our story like we did to many, and he did not even think for a moment but said , he was delighted to give his vacant house which was adjoined to his house on rent t.
There was something that made me have an instant affection to this man, maybe I saw my grandfather in him. The way he dressed himself, the purity in the English he spoke all reminded me of my grandfather who had passed away for a year then. This man was fondly respected by all as annaya, “Joseph Annaya”. His wife Philomena , sons , daughters, grandchildren… all god fearing people. It is now going to be a good 8 years we have come to this place. Sometimes, we both wonder , why have we not moved… what has made us stay here… maybe it was his affection always made us feel so comfortable and made us reluctant to move....

Even my daughter is so attached to them that every evening it is her playtime in their portico. All our communication address always bore “C/O Joseph Annaya” Coz he used to collect our posts to ensure it is not lost. Who would do it from today…..

He reached the arms of Jesus peacefully today morning while he was doing his morning walk in the portico. His face was the most peaceful as though he had embraced death with joy

Last Sunday he celebrated his 53 wedding anniversary in the church, and today we are in the church mass praying for “his soul to rest in peace” . He set set out on his Last Journey today to enjoy heavenly bliss forever
